  5. Zurich won the league by 14 points over FC Basel. Zurich had a crowd of 32,000 for the game they lifted the league trophy... I wish we had crowds like this more often Lugano won the swiss Cup with a 4-1 win over St Gallen. This is Lugano first trophy in 29 years. They'll be joined in the conference league by Young Boys and Basel. In the Challenge League Winterthuer won promotion to the top league for the first time in 40 years. Luzern beat Schaffhausen 4-2 on aggregate to remain in the Super League. The big story is that starting from the 2023/24 the Super League will be moving to 12 teams. Meaning there will be no direct relegation next season as 10th will play whoever finishes 3rd in the Challenge League for the last ticket. The one thing I don't agree with is the top two at the end of the league season will play a best of 3 series to decide the champion. I'm okay if the SFL want to copy Austria but the league title being decided by a head to head series sounds stupid to me. Young Boys rejected the proposal but weirdly Basel voted for it.
